Reference and FAQ The primary documentation for BIND is the ARM, the Administrator's Reference Manual. There is a separate edition of the ARM for each major release of BIND. You can download the PDF file of the ARM for BIND 9.8<http://ftp.isc.org/isc/bind9/cur/9.8/doc/arm/Bv9ARM.pdf>, BIND 9.7<http://ftp.isc.org/isc/bind9/cur/9.7/doc/arm/Bv9ARM.pdf>, BIND 9.6<http://ftp.isc.org/isc/bind9/cur/9.6/doc/arm/Bv9ARM.pdf>, BIND 9.5<http://www.isc.org/files/Bv9.5.2ARM.pdf>, BIND 9.4<http://www.isc.org/files/Bv9.4ARM.pdf>. HTML versions are available for BIND 9.8<http://ftp.isc.org/isc/bind9/cur/9.8/doc/arm/Bv9ARM.html>, BIND 9.7<http://ftp.isc.org/isc/bind9/cur/9.7/doc/arm/Bv9ARM.html>, BIND 9.6<http://ftp.isc.org/isc/bind9/cur/9.6/doc/arm/Bv9ARM.html>, BIND 9.5<http://www.isc.org/files/arm95_0.html> and BIND 9.4<http://www.isc.org/files/arm94_0.html>. From time to time we issue a small addendum to the most recent ARM, which documents new features that were made available since the ARM was published. This note<http://www.isc.org/software/bind/delegation-only> about ISC's BIND Delegation-only feature is an addendum to the BIND 9.5 ARM.
